How to Figure Out Your Liquid Net Worth: Quick Guide

Figuring out your liquid net worth starts with understanding what you can access in cash within 30 days. This snapshot reflects your true financial flexibility for emergencies, opportunities, or obligations.

Use the framework below to translate everyday bank balances into a clear, defendable number that you can revisit each month.

How To Calculate Liquid Assets

Cash and Cash Equivalents

Start with balances that you can tap today, including checking, savings, and currency. Add any short‑term CDs and Treasury bills that mature within 90 days.

Subtract Short‑Term Liabilities

Deduct balances owed within the next month, such as credit card balances, upcoming bills, and short‑term personal loans. The result is your liquid net worth.

Why Liquid Net Worth Matters

Emergency Readiness

A strong liquid position means you can handle car repairs, medical bills, or sudden job loss without high‑interest debt. Aim for at least three to six months of core expenses.

Financial Flexibility

When opportunities arise, such as a down payment or a time‑sensitive investment, liquid funds let you move quickly. Tracking this number monthly keeps you ready.

Liquid Net Worth vs Total Net Worth

Key Differences

Total net worth includes your home, retirement accounts, and long‑term investments, while liquid net worth focuses only on cash and near‑cash items. Both matter, but they serve different goals.

Take Action on Your Liquid Net Worth

  • List every account where cash is available within 30 days
  • Add up balances in checking, savings, and short‑term instruments
  • Subtract all bills and loan payments due in the next month
  • Record the result and track changes month over month
  • Set a target equal to at least three months of essential expenses
  • Automate transfers to keep your buffer consistently funded

How often should I calculate my liquid net worth?

Review it at the start of each month and again after any major transaction, such as a big purchase or a market swing.

Should I include pending transfers in my liquid net worth?

Only count money that is already cleared and available; pending transfers can fail or be delayed.

What if I have a line of credit but no cash?

A line of credit is not an asset until you can draw on it without fees; treat it as potential liquidity, not current liquid net worth.

Is my emergency fund part of liquid net worth?

Yes, the portion of your emergency fund held in cash or short‑term accounts is included, as long as it remains accessible.
